Brian Kelly has held off on awarding the No. 18 jersey, a legacy at LSU, so far this fall, which is Kelly’s first in Baton Rouge.

But, on Saturday, that changed, as the first-year coach of the Tigers gave the jersey to a star defender, who could end up being a first-round pick in the 2023 NFL Draft.

As you can see below, Kelly presented the number to edge rusher BJ Ojulari after Saturday’s practice session:

Ojulari has emerged as a team leader this year, coming off a 2021 campaign that saw him record 54 tackles (12 for a loss) and a team-high 7 sacks.
